In an update regarding the upcoming Alabama men's basketball game against Missouri, it has been confirmed that the game will proceed as planned with a tip-off time of 6 p.m. CT in Coleman Coliseum.

The university has made arrangements to expand the student section for tonight's game by providing additional seating in unsold areas throughout the stadium. This move aims to accommodate more students and enhance the overall game atmosphere. At the under 16:00 timeout in the first half, fans will have the opportunity to move closer to the court and occupy any unused seats.

It should be noted that no reserved parking will be available in the Coleman Coliseum lot for this game. Fans attending the event are urged to exercise caution and stay updated on the latest local weather and road conditions before traveling to the campus.
